>Not sure if the SB220 is like the SB200, but the stock SB200 use a 120 vdc
>relay that is keyed by -120 volts.  You don't want to hook this up directly
>to the 1000MP solid state keying output without a level shifter having
>sufficient current capability and spike protection.

Elliot's right, which is the point of the high voltage transistor 
switch.  I use a MOSFET and steal the switching voltage from one of the 
connectors on the back of the radio.
